Garage Door Banging Sound

Banging noises are often caused by out of balance doors.  It's best to get this issue addressed sooner rather than later to prevent other damage from occurring.

Weather Stripping Repair

As your garage door ages, the weather stripping or trim may deteriorate and need replacement.  Replacing the weather stripping will help insulate your garage and keep unwanted critters outside.

Rattling Garage Door Sounds

Rattling sounds may be caused by lo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ing greasing , unbalanced doors, or a garage door opener that was not correctly installed.

Garage Door Scraping Sounds

Scraping sounds are sometimes due to misaligned doors.

Squeaking Garage Door

Squeaking sounds might be the result of a loose roller or hinge, parts needing greasing, or unbalanced doors.

Rubbing Noise Garage Door

Rubbing could be caused by b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s adjusting.

Grinding Noise Garage Door

Grinding noises might be caused by parts needing lubrication,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an improperly installed opener.

Slapping Garage Door Noise

Slapping noises are generally caused by a loose chain.

Vibrating Garage Door Noise

Vibrating noises are generally caused by loose parts or rollers needing lubrication.

Popping Sound Garage Door

Popping sounds might be the result of torsion spring issues.

Garage Door Opener Installation

The average life of a garage door opener is approximately 10-15 years. Regular upkeep, lubrication, and taking care to be sure your garage door is balanced will aid in extending the life of your opener. For safety reasons, if you have a garage door opener that was purchased before 1993, it’s advisable to have it replaced instead of repaired.
